What is a Built-In Oven?
A built-in oven is designed to be integrated into kitchen area cabinetry, enabling a seamless appearance that enhances the overall aesthetic of the area. Unlike freestanding models, which inhabit flooring space and can appear large, built-in ovens are set up within the cabinets, either at eye level or under the countertop, offering benefit and availability.
